The Tufts University has developed a tattoo-like sensor that detects the blood oxygen level of the patient. The novel sensor is primarily made of gel formed from the protein components of silk, known as fibroin. POSTECH, a research group, worked with the UNIST School to develop a wearable sensor patch that is smaller than a hair strand and accurately captures pulse wave signals. Overview of Wearable Bioelectronic Skin Patches Market Wearable bioelectric skin patches are flexible & thin skin patches that are attached to the user’s skin with biocompatible adhesives. They primarily comprise sensors, actuators, processors, and communication elements. Changing Lifestyle of People Worldwide to Boost Demand for Wearable Biolectronic Skin Patches The fast-paced work environment, along with irregular eating habits and a lack of physical activity have resulted in the rise of several serious lifestyle ailments, with heart disease becoming highly prevalent. Therefore, it is critical to monitor the body's vital signs, as neglecting essential warning signs may prove fatal. Wearable bioelectric skin patches have the potential to help monitor the body’s vital signs and prevent such tragic events. Additionally, cardiac function is decided through the interplay of four variables: coronary heart rate, preload, contractility, and afterload. Quantifying particular coronary heart functions is extraordinarily difficult, and poses vital challenges. Initially, either an intrusive pressure approach or a highly sophisticated echocardiographic technique is used. Moreover, each component depends on the others. Hence, a failure in a single component is likely to have an impact on the associated components. In such instances, a wearable bioelectric pores and skin patch is the ideal choice for cardiovascular tracking, as it is non-invasive and convenient. Electrophysiological Segment to Propel Global Market In terms of electronic skin sensors, the global wearable bioelectronic skin patches market has been classified into electrophysiological, biochemical, potentiometric and others. The electrophysiological, biochemical, potentiometric, and other segments of the global wearable bioelectronic skin patches market have been categorized. In 2021, the electrophysiology segment accounted for a significant share of the global market. Due to its unique qualities, including as stretch ability, conformal interfaces with skin, biocompatibility, and wearable comfort, on-skin electrode functions act as a unique platform for gathering high-quality electrophysiological signals.
